Authorizing City Council's Committee on Commerce & Economic Development to hold hearings regarding comprehensive qualitative and quantitative efforts to improve the ease of doing business in the City of Philadelphia.

WHEREAS

,

Philadelphia is a vibrant metropolitan area that strives to create an environment conducive to unparalleled business success and job growth; and

WHEREAS

,

Both City Council and the Kenney Administration desire to advance a regulatory environment that is increasingly favorable to the lawful establishment and operation of local businesses; and

WHEREAS

,

Fundamental to the premise of such an environment are predictability in process and quality in customer service, as well as rules that protect against abuses to either; and

WHEREAS

,

Qualitative and quantitative measures exist for how cities can improve regulatory rules for starting a business, permitting, employing workers, taxes and other indices; and

WHEREAS

,

The utilization of such data can help to establish optimal levels of business service, inclusive of acceptable procedural times, while adequately considering social protections; and

WHEREAS

,

Studies have found that the best functioning economies boast uncomplicated rules that enable businesses of all sizes and origins to easily establish themselves, grow and hire; and

WHEREAS

,

The City of Philadelphia seeks to improve its standing amongst the Nation’s cities with regard to ease of doing business through the streamlining of processes and lowering of costs: and

WHEREAS

,

City Council created, empaneled and authorized the Special Committee on Regulatory Review & Reform with a mission to identify archaic, superfluous, and confusing provisions in the Philadelphia Code and in departmental regulations; and to recommend revisions that streamline, clarify and enhance the City’s regulatory environment, for the purpose of accelerating the growth of well-paying jobs in Philadelphia while ensuring the safety and well-being of its residents; and

WHEREAS

,

The Administration, through the Department of Commerce, is committed to ensuring respectful, efficient, and timely service for all business owners who interact with the city; and recently adopted the Business Owners Bill of Rights to that end; and

WHEREAS

,

Continuous consideration of ongoing improvements in service delivery - including those that dive into the processes specific industries must undertake - can yield more data, evidence and insight, thereby helping to ensure comprehensive results; now, therefore, be it

RESOLVED, That City Council’s Committee on Commerce & Economic Development be authorized to hold hearings regarding comprehensive qualitative and quantitative efforts to improve the ease of doing business in city of Philadelphia.
